Description of activities

The following activities were carried out: Participant registration. Presentation of the quarterly mediation and dissemination activities for the 2020 Education and Training Plan. Presentation of the participants' different educational systems. Exchange of current teaching challenges. Creative ICT game workshops in Drenthe. Lego workshops/games. Painting and music workshop. Creative teaching methods in Zuidlaren. Visit to the De Wachter Museum, workshops to motivate students through music and painting. Digi Lounge and Digi Studio. Group work and advertorial. Photography workshop.

Objectives
  • European Union policy objective : Education systems adapted to the changing times. Training our students in entrepreneurial strategies tailored to their level.
  • Objective of the Erasmus+ programme: To improve the level of key skills and competences through learning mobility and cooperation.
  • Europe 2020 Strategy objective : reduction of the early school dropout rate from 14% to less than 10% in Spain. Our goal is to reduce school failure with more active and creative methodologies.
  • Education and Training 2020 Goal: Increase creativity and innovation, including entrepreneurship, at all levels of education.
  • Erasmus+ horizontal objective: develop basic and transversal skills (entrepreneurship, digital and linguistic skills).
  • Vertical or sectoral objective (school sector): Addressing student underperformance in basic skills with multidisciplinary and interdisciplinary approaches, innovative teaching materials, and multilingual classrooms.
Results

Despite being almost entirely affected by COVID-19, we have widely disseminated the activity among teachers and students. Some of the activities are easy to implement at school. We have also integrated them into the curriculum through our Integrated Teaching Units.

The following activities have been particularly interesting, with very positive results among students and teachers:

  • Reflection on the problems and needs of the education system in Europe.
  • Creativity through painting and music.
  • Painting workshop with different colors and musical styles.
  • Creative group games with Lego.
  • Organization of virtual/in-person treasure hunts.
